C++ main module for gpm Package  1.0
MATH_UnaryOperator Member List

This is the complete list of members for MATH_UnaryOperator, including all inherited members.

addArgument(SP::MATH_ChildExpression operand)MATH_NodeExpressionvirtual
addArgument(MATH_ChildExpression *operand)MATH_NodeExpressioninlinevirtual
MATH_ParentExpression::ALGEBRICMATH_Expressionstatic
MATH_ChildExpression::ALGEBRICMATH_Expressionstatic
MATH_ParentExpression::COMPUTE_BOUNDSMATH_Expressionstatic
MATH_ChildExpression::COMPUTE_BOUNDSMATH_Expressionstatic
CORE_Object()CORE_Objectprotected
evaluate(const tFlag &action, MATH_Environment &symbols, MATH_Variable &var) const MATH_NodeExpressioninlinevirtual
MATH_ParentExpression::MATH_Expression::evaluate(MATH_Environment &symbols, MATH_Variable &value) const MATH_Expressioninline
MATH_ChildExpression::evaluate(MATH_Environment &symbols, MATH_Variable &value) const MATH_Expressioninline
MATH_ParentExpression::FAILMATH_Expressionstatic
MATH_ChildExpression::FAILMATH_Expressionstatic
getArgument(const int &i) const MATH_ParentExpressioninline
getArgument(const int &i)MATH_ParentExpressioninline
getArgumentsNumber() const MATH_ParentExpressioninline
getAssociatedBinaryOperator()MATH_UnaryOperatorinline
getClassName(const tString &identityString)CORE_Objectinlinestatic
getClassName() const CORE_Object
getIdentityString() const CORE_Objectinline
getName() const MATH_Operatorinline
getOutput()CORE_Objectinlinestatic
getParent(int &index)MATH_ChildExpressioninline
getParent(int &index) const MATH_ChildExpressioninline
getParent()MATH_ChildExpressioninline
getParent() const MATH_ChildExpressioninline
getPointerAddress() const CORE_Objectinline
getRootNode() const MATH_NodeExpressioninlinevirtual
getSharedPointer(SP::CORE_Object &p)CORE_Objectinline
getSharedPointer(SPC::CORE_Object &p) const CORE_Objectinline
getTypeName()CORE_Objectinlinestatic
insertInTree(MATH_Expression *tree, MATH_Environment &symbols, tString &expr)MATH_UnaryOperatorvirtual
is32Architecture()CORE_Objectinlinestatic
is64Architecture()CORE_Objectstatic
MATH_ParentExpression::IS_INSIDEMATH_Expressionstatic
MATH_ChildExpression::IS_INSIDEMATH_Expressionstatic
isInstanceOf() const CORE_Objectinline
MATH_ChildExpression(void)MATH_ChildExpressionprotected
MATH_ParentExpression::MATH_Expression(void)MATH_Expressionprotected
MATH_ChildExpression::MATH_Expression(void)MATH_Expressionprotected
MATH_NodeExpression(void)MATH_NodeExpressionprotected
MATH_Operator(void)MATH_Operatorprotected
MATH_ParentExpression(void)MATH_ParentExpressionprotected
MATH_UnaryOperator(void)MATH_UnaryOperatorprotected
mIsMemoryTestingCORE_Objectstatic
newInstance() const =0MATH_NodeExpressionpure virtual
MATH_ParentExpression::NULL_OPERANDMATH_Expressionstatic
MATH_ChildExpression::NULL_OPERANDMATH_Expressionstatic
MATH_ParentExpression::OUT_OF_BOUNDSMATH_Expressionstatic
MATH_ChildExpression::OUT_OF_BOUNDSMATH_Expressionstatic
outputPrint(const tString &message)CORE_Objectstatic
pointer2String(const void *obj)CORE_Objectstatic
print()CORE_Objectinlinevirtual
print(ostream &out) const CORE_Objectinlinevirtual
print(const tString &message)CORE_Objectvirtual
print(const tInteger &str)CORE_Objectvirtual
print(const tRelativeInteger &str)CORE_Objectvirtual
print(const tReal &str)CORE_Objectvirtual
print(const int &str)CORE_Objectvirtual
print(ostream &out, const tString &message)CORE_Objectinlinestatic
printObjectsInMemory()CORE_Objectstatic
resetArgument(const int &index)MATH_ParentExpression
resetArguments()MATH_ParentExpressioninline
resetParent()MATH_ChildExpression
setArgument(const int &index, SP::MATH_ChildExpression org)MATH_ParentExpression
setArgument(const int &index, MATH_ChildExpression *arg)MATH_ParentExpressioninline
setArgumentsNumber(const int &n)MATH_ParentExpressioninline
setAssociatedBinaryOperator(SP::MATH_BinaryOperator op)MATH_UnaryOperatorinlineprotected
setName(const tString &n)MATH_Operatorinlineprotected
setOutput(ostream &out)CORE_Objectinlinestatic
setParent(SP::MATH_ParentExpression parent, const int &argIndex)MATH_ChildExpression
setThis(SP::CORE_Object p)CORE_Objectinlineprotected
setType(tString type)CORE_Objectinlineprotectedvirtual
MATH_ParentExpression::SIZE_MISMATCHEDMATH_Expressionstatic
MATH_ChildExpression::SIZE_MISMATCHEDMATH_Expressionstatic
MATH_ParentExpression::SUCCESSMATH_Expressionstatic
MATH_ChildExpression::SUCCESSMATH_Expressionstatic
toDoAfterThisSetting()CORE_Objectinlineprotectedvirtual
toString() const MATH_UnaryOperatorvirtual
MATH_ParentExpression::TYPE_MISMATCHEDMATH_Expressionstatic
MATH_ChildExpression::TYPE_MISMATCHEDMATH_Expressionstatic
~CORE_Object()CORE_Objectprotectedvirtual
~MATH_ChildExpression(void)MATH_ChildExpressionprotectedvirtual
~MATH_Expression(void)MATH_Expressionprotectedvirtual
~MATH_NodeExpression(void)MATH_NodeExpressionprotectedvirtual
~MATH_Operator(void)MATH_Operatorprotectedvirtual
~MATH_ParentExpression(void)MATH_ParentExpressionprotectedvirtual
~MATH_UnaryOperator(void)MATH_UnaryOperatorprotectedvirtual